I wouln't hold my breath. I got commissioned 2 weeks ago and only received my tentative report date which was Sept 2. From what I've heard they don't cut you your official orders until about 30 days prior to report date. The word is all PLC summer 04 commissions are being assigned to Fox or Alpha. Are you commissioned yet? If you havn't been commissioned don't even worry about your orders to TBS they won't be processed until your commissioning paperwork clears HQ Marine Corps and even then they will only assign a tentative date which is by no means final. They could send you sooner or later depending on you situation. You will definitly know your tentative report date when you get commissioned because its all on the same paperwork.

I haven't been commissioned yet and they have recieved my tentative date. They may choose not to tell you that until your commissioned, but I don't know why that would be. As soon as they get your request for appointment paper work back it should have a tentative date. But it is true that you will not get your orders until aprx. 30 days prior to report. And it is tentative, if they have a slot and your number comes up, your going. I have heard of them giving only a week or two notice sometimes.

EA-6B1 said:
So am I getting the run-around when my OSO tells me that I'll get flight time my last semester of school, and after PLC srs? Thats what I was told.

There is a difference. Your OSO is telling you about FIP. Flight Indoc. Program. IFS, is for those who haven't completed FIP. So he is telling you right. At some point you will have to go through some flight training, either during or after school.
